mojaSymfonia FORUM
https://forum.mix-soft.pl/

Cena brutto w inwentaryzacji
https://forum.mix-soft.pl/viewtopic.php?f=15&t=532
Strona 1 z 1

Autor:  gregor [ 2009-01-21, 22:54 ]
Tytuł:  Cena brutto w inwentaryzacji

Napisałem post w "Programach Handlowych, ale raczej to temat dla programistów...

Czy jest możliwość dodania kolumny w wydruku inwentaryzacji wg dostaw z ceną "D"-brutto oraz stawką VAT.
Tak sobie życzy nasza księgowa. A może jest inny sposób na taką dokładkę.

z góry dziękuję.

Autor:  rafal [ 2009-01-22, 12:34 ]
Tytuł: 

Raporty → Dokumenty → Inwentaryzacja → Arkusz inwentaryzacyjny wg dostaw → Inwentaryzacja wg dostaw

ZNAJDŹ
Kod:
NoDate=1
typWydruku = Val( Arg0 )

WSTAW POD
Kod:
   MapValue mvSt
   mvSt.Type( string )

   baseXT xt
   int xtErr

   xt.SetKey("super")
   xt.SetKeySeg("super",10000)
   xt.SetKeySeg("kod","")
   
   xtErr = xt.GetRec( GE )
   while xtErr == 0
      if xt.GetField("super") != 10000 then exit
      mvSt.Set( (using "%d",xt.GetField("subtypi")),xt.GetField("kod") )

      xtErr = xt.GetRec( NX )
   wend

ZNAJDŹ
Kod:
kolumny = 13- !bDostawy- !bData- !bWartBiez- !bWartSpis- !bRoznIlos- !bRoznWart- !bStanBiez- !bStanSpis-!bKodP -!PrawoDoCen

ZAMIEŃ NA
Kod:
kolumny = 13- !bDostawy- !bData- !bWartBiez- !bWartSpis- !bRoznIlos- !bRoznWart- !bStanBiez- !bStanSpis-!bKodP -!PrawoDoCen + 2

ZNAJDŹ
Kod:
if bRoznWart then KolTab(i)=nKwotaWt : i+=1

WSTAW POD
Kod:
KolTab(i)=200 : i+=1//cenaD
KolTab(i)=200 : i+=1//stawka

ZNAJDŹ
Kod:
if bRoznWart then asKolNames(i)="Różnica wartości" : i+=1

WSTAW POD
Kod:
asKolNames(i)="Cena D" : i+=1//cenaD
asKolNames(i)="Stawka VAT" : i+=1//stawka

ZNAJDŹ
Kod:
if bRoznWart then StlTab(i)=kr : StlTabB(i)=br : i+=1

WSTAW POD
Kod:
StlTab(i)=kr : StlTabB(i)=br : i+=1 // cena D
StlTab(i)=kr : StlTabB(i)=br : i+=1 // stawka

ZNAJDŹ
Kod:
   if bWartSpis && bPuste then kolumna i, Kwota(fStanSpis*fCena) : i+=1
   if bRoznIlos && bPuste then nKolIlosc = i : i+=1

WSTAW POD
Kod:
   kolumna i, Kwota(GetField(tw,"cenaD")):i+=1 // cena D
   kolumna i, mvSt.Get( (using "%d",GetField(tw,"vatspi")),"-" ):i+=1 // stawka

ZNAJDŹ
Kod:
   if bWartBiez then i+=bRoznIlos
endif
   f bRoznWart then kolumna i, Kwota( fSumaRozn )
endif

WSTAW POD
Kod:
   kolumna i, Kwota( 0 ) : i+=1 // cenaD
   kolumna i, Kwota( 0 ) : i+=1 // stawka


[center]Obrazek [/center]

Autor:  gregor [ 2009-01-23, 00:44 ]
Tytuł: 

Bardzo dziękuje za szybki post. W Handlu odpisałem na zapytanie dlaczego to wszuystko.
Jednak przerobiłem ten raport i chyba coś źle zrobiłem, bo wyskoczył taki komunikat"

Obrazek
mały ten screen "Wartość indeksu:10 przekracza dopuszczalny rozmiar plik:.... linia.....

co zrobiłem źle?
Mam Handel 2007- proszę o cały raport

Autor:  gregor [ 2009-01-23, 08:12 ]
Tytuł: 

Drogi Rafale
Proszę-jak to możliwe zamieścić cały ten raport, ponieważ z tymi podstawieniami nie funkcjonuje.

pozdrawiam

Autor:  rafal [ 2009-01-23, 08:47 ]
Tytuł: 

cały raport dla wersji HMP 2009a

Załączniki:
Komentarz: Inwentaryzacja wg dostaw
inwentar.zip [5.72 KiB]
Pobrany 486 razy

Autor:  gregor [ 2009-01-23, 13:20 ]
Tytuł: 

Drogi Rafale
Co oznacza komunikat:
Błąd składnika języka
niezdefiniowany symbol PR_CW_MG_VIEW


Jestem administratorem programu- jeśli o to chodzi

pozdrawiam

Autor:  rafal [ 2009-01-23, 13:45 ]
Tytuł: 

którą masz wersję programu?

Autor:  gregor [ 2009-01-23, 17:28 ]
Tytuł: 

Wersje mam: 1 firma 2007c
2 firma 2008a

Autor:  rafal [ 2009-01-23, 17:56 ]
Tytuł: 

aktualizuj się ... www.mojaSymfonia.pl

Strona 1 z 1 Strefa czasowa UTC+1godz. [letni]
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
http://www.phpbb.com/